The MAC Powder Kisses, which are a relatively new formula in the MAC fam, feel lighter than air. The Powder Kisses themselves were added to the permanent line in the fall of 2018, and if your lips are in best shape (as in no flakes), they’re kind of amaze-balls. They’re incredibly comfy and ever-so-slightly moisturizing, and it’s easy to forget I’m wearing them.

And the velvet matte finish? Gorgeous! — a la hottie 1940’s pin-up girl.

From this new batch of colors, I’d steer clear of the pinks (Reverence and sexy but Sweet), because they’re patchy ideal out of the gate, and I end up having to do a lot of patting and layering and babying to get them to look smooth…

Instead, choose one of brighter or deeper colors, which are less likely to clear up into fine lines or draw attention to any flakes. I like Sultry step (the bright rosy brown); Werk, Werk, Werk (the amazing toned red); and velvet Punch (a bright, amazing fuchsia) the best as they’re the most pigmented of the bunch.

One layer, and I’m good.

Yellow-toned pink MAC Sexy, but Sweet
MAC Ripened, a grayish lavender

MAC P for Potent, a mid-toned purple

MAC velvet Punch, a bright, cool-toned fuchsia

MAC Sultry Move, a bright rosy brown
Cool red MAC Werk, Werk, Werk
MAC stay Curious, a muted pinky red
MAC Reverence, a soft, yellow pink
The Powder Kiss Lipsticks are $19 each, last about two hours on my lips, and taste and smell like classic MAC vanilla.
